  9. F6HAD

    Headlights - Are they Xenon or Halogen

    Only the Pre facelift 2.4 Exec came with factory xenon’s in the 7th gen, and only the Type S 180 has them in the 8th gen. The JDM Euro R also has them. Safe to say yours will be halogen whichever generation it is.

  11. F6HAD

    INJECTOR BLOWOUT.

    It’s not very common but it can happen, seen it on various diesel engines. Are the threads in the head strong enough to hold the new bolt in? Sometimes you need to tap a new thread in or oversize drill and helicoil.
